Crwys Road Welsh Calvinistic Methodist Chapel, Grade II listed chapel in Roath, Cardiff, United Kingdom

Crwys Road Welsh Calvinistic Methodist Chapel is a Grade II listed building in Roath, Cardiff, designed to serve religious gatherings and community activities. It contains multiple levels with a main worship area, gallery space, and lower floor rooms for various purposes.

The chapel was built in 1899 by architect John H Phillips as a Methodist place of worship. It was later transformed into Shah Jalal Mosque to serve Cardiff's growing Islamic community.

The structure reflects how different faith communities have shaped the same religious space over time. Its architectural style shows the religious preferences of late Victorian Cardiff and how worship traditions have evolved within its walls.

The building is located in a central area of Cardiff and is easily accessible to visitors. It remains an active place of worship and community gatherings, so checking ahead about access times is recommended before visiting.

The structure combines architectural elements from Dutch Baroque and medieval styles, which was characteristic of religious buildings from that era. This stylistic blend creates a distinctive appearance that differs from typical Victorian chapels in the region.
